Betty and Veronica Comics Digest Magazine #19
In "That's Good," Veronica takes the reins of Mr. Lodge’s struggling cookie factory, teaming up with Betty to turn things around—only to face a surprise twist when Mr. Lodge unknowingly sells the now-profitable business. Written by Jim Ruth and brought to life with crisp art by Rex Lindsey, inks by Mike Esposito, and vibrant colors by Barry Grossman and Lisa Goldwater, this 1986 digest issue captures the classic Archie charm. The cover by Dan DeCarlo perfectly captures the lighthearted tension of the moment.
